- [ ] Step 7: Archive cold storage buckets (Glacierline tier). Confirm both ceremony witnesses are present, verify bucket manifests match the Oxbow ledger, then seal the archive key shares. Plugin authors may observe but not handle shares. Once sealed, the archive index itself is encrypted and can only be reopened with the passphrase below.

vault phrase of badup-hahig = tamael-aldael-kelmir-istael-fenok-istwyn-tamius-jorath-oliion

Quick intro for the sync: Togglewick is our feature-flag rollout framework. Flags ship off by default, ramp by percentage, and auto-revert if error rates spike. New flags need an owner and an expiry date — no zombie flags, please. For access, ramp approvals, or general Togglewick questions, ping the platform crew here.

escalation mailbox, yajeg-bageg: quenax.olidor@lumiccorp.internal

Q2 Planning Note — Second-Source Supplier Search

For the incoming director: Vantrell Components remains our sole resin supplier. Risk is unacceptable. We have shortlisted two alternatives, Corbay Polymers and Hessel Works, with trial orders planned next quarter. Qualification budget is approved; timelines are tight. Background on the strategic angle is captured in the confidential note below.

board note of kageg-bahof: The renewal with Holwynax Holdings closes at $2 million a year, 5 percent below the last contract. Project Ulaath slips by two quarters because of the supplier delay.